SpaceX Makes Historic Wall Street Debut with Record IPO
Elon Musk's SpaceX has officially entered the public market, marking its first day of trading on Wall Street with the largest IPO in history.

On June 12, 2026, SpaceX commenced trading on Wall Street, achieving a significant milestone as it became a public company.
This debut is notable for being the largest initial public offering ever recorded, reflecting substantial investor interest.
Founded by Elon Musk, SpaceX continues to pursue ambitious goals, including plans to facilitate human travel to Mars.
